| 需要金币: |
资料包括:完整论文 | ![]() | |
| 转换比率:金额 X 10=金币数量, 例100元=1000金币 | 论文字数:9396 | ||
| 折扣与优惠:团购最低可5折优惠 - 了解详情 | 论文格式:Word格式(*.doc) |
摘要:进入21世纪以来,温度和湿度的检测已经成为众多行业的重要工作之一,环境温湿度检测逐渐成为了人们日常生活中不可或缺的一环。随着温湿度检测技术的不断发展,现在的温湿度检测已经得到了广大居民住户的一致认可。 本文采用FPGA为控制核心,设计了一种基于FPGA的温湿度检测系统。设计主要包括顶层模块、DHT11驱动模块、按键模块和数码管显示模块。使用Verilog HDL语言和Quartus II集成开发工具进行开发,完成基于FPGA的温湿度检测系统的设计,根据仿真结果验证了设计的正确性,然后进行硬件测试,基本达到预期控制要求,实现对环境的温度以及湿度的检测。 关 键 词:FPGA;温湿度检测;Quartus II
目录 摘要 Abstract 第一章 绪论-1 1.1 目的及研究意义-1 1.2 国内外的研究现状-1 1.3 研究内容-2 第二章 开发工具和关键技术-3 2.1 可编程逻辑器件FPGA的介绍-3 2.2 开发软件工具Quartus Ⅱ简介-3 2.3 仿真工具Modelism简介-3 2.4 DHT11芯片简介-4 2.5 开拓者开发板特点简介-4 第三章 系统的设计-5 3.1 总体设计与分析-5 3.2 系统设计框图-5 第四章 系统调试与结果显示-7 4.1 DHT11驱动模块-7 4.1.1 DHT11驱动模块代码-7 4.1.2 DHT11驱动模块的元件图-8 4.1.3 DHT11驱动模块的仿真波形-8 4.2 按键控制模块-9 4.2.1 按键控制模块代码-9 4.2.2 按键控制模块的元件图-10 4.2.3 按键控制模块的仿真波形-10 4.3 按键消抖模块-11 4.3.1 按键消抖模块代码-11 4.3.2 按键消抖模块的元件图-12 4.3.3 按键消抖模块的仿真波形-13 4.4 数码管显示模块-13 4.4.1 数码管显示模块代码-13 4.4.2 数码管显示模块的元件图-14 4.4.3 数码管显示模块的仿真波形-14 4.5 总体仿真-15 4.5.1 顶层模块原理图-15 4.5.2 顶层模块代码-15 4.5.3 顶层模块的元件图-17 4.5.4 顶层模块的仿真波形-17 4.6 硬件实现-18 4.7 不足之处-23 结束语-24 参考文献-25 致 谢-26 |

